Between August 28 and 30, the fifth edition of the MEO Kalorama festival took place at Parque da Bela Vista, in Lisbon, which received more than 100,000 people over the three days. The event presented a diverse programming that covered varied musical styles, from pop to punk, seeking to offer experiences for all tastes.
